Battery, Runtime, and Charging: Real‑World Expectations for 150‑Minute Claims

Because the ET2310‑01 uses a 3‑cell, 2000 Wh lithium‑ion pack, you can realistically expect close to the advertised 150 minutes in light‑to‑moderate conditions, but heavy debris, steep walls, or colder water will cut that runtime noticeably. You’ll appreciate the true-world balance: the battery chemistry offers high energy density, but you should manage charging habits to protect capacity. Avoid full‑drain cycles, recharge after use, and don’t leave the pack depleted during seasonal storage. Expect some runtime degradation over years; with good care you’ll keep usable run times long enough to clean most above‑ground pools reliably. Does the Cleaner Work in Saltwater Pools?

Yes — you can use it in saltwater pools, but you’ll want to check corrosion resistance and maintenance needs. You’ll appreciate cordless freedom and smart edge navigation, yet salt can accelerate wear on metals and electrical seals. Rinse the unit with fresh water after use, dry and store it, and follow manufacturer warranty guidance. That way you’ll protect performance, prolong battery life, and feel confident the cleaner will keep doing its job.

Can I Use Replacement Batteries From Third Parties?

Yes — you can use third-party replacement batteries, but check battery compatibility carefully and expect potential warranty implications if the cell specifications or installation differ from the original. You’ll want a lithium‑ion pack matching voltage, capacity, and connector type to keep performance and safety. If you prefer guaranteed coverage, contact STARRYBOT for authorized replacements; otherwise choose a reputable supplier and keep records so you still feel supported.
